Market Context

Trading volume for CINF in recent sessions has been near long-term average levels, with no unusual spikes or dips observed in this month’s trading activity, suggesting no significant unannounced company-specific news is driving current price action. The broader insurance sector has seen mixed performance in recent weeks, as market participants adjust their positioning based on evolving expectations for monetary policy in upcoming months. P&C insurers like Cincinnati Financial are particularly sensitive to interest rate shifts, as changes to benchmark rates can impact returns on their large investment portfolios, a core driver of profitability for the sector. Analysts estimate that sector-wide sentiment may remain volatile in the near term as markets price in potential policy adjustments, which could create ripple effects for individual stocks including CINF. Technical Analysis

Currently, CINF is trading squarely between its two most closely watched near-term technical levels: support at $150.21 and resistance at $166.03. The $150.21 support level has been tested multiple times in recent weeks, with buyers stepping in to push shares higher each time the stock has approached that threshold, indicating potential strong buying interest at that price point. The $166.03 resistance level, by contrast, has acted as a consistent ceiling for price action in recent months, with prior attempts to break above that level failing to hold on a sustained basis.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the mid-40s, signaling a neutral momentum profile with no clear overbought or oversold conditions at present. CINF is also trading near its short-term moving averages, while longer-term moving averages sit slightly above the current price, pointing to a lack of clear near-term trend direction for the stock. Volatility for the stock has remained in line with its peer group in the P&C insurance space, with no outsized daily price swings recorded in recent sessions.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key scenarios that market participants may watch for CINF in the coming weeks. If the stock moves toward the $166.03 resistance level on above-average volume, that could potentially signal building bullish momentum, with sustained trading above that level possibly opening the door for further range expansion to the upside. On the downside, a break below the $150.21 support level on high volume might lead to increased selling pressure, as technical traders may adjust their positions in response to the break of a well-established support threshold. Broader market factors, including shifts in interest rate expectations and sector-wide moves in the insurance space, would likely impact CINF’s performance alongside technical dynamics, and investors may also be watching for any upcoming announcements from the company related to operational updates or earnings release timelines. Without imminent company-specific fundamental news on the horizon, technical levels are expected to play a particularly prominent role in driving near-term price action for Cincinnati Financial.
